Default FS: JDM (I think) front lip for BD/BG

As mentioned in this post a while back, I bought a front lip from JHot (place that sells JDM stuff on Ebay). I really only wanted the rear black plastic underbumper piece, but they were paired and I got 'em together for all of $30 + S/H, so I wasn't going to complain about getting the lip, too. Upon receiving it I realized that it wouldn't fit on a 2.5GT bumper, so it was kind of worthless to me. I've thought about perhaps incorporating it into a home-brewed deep front splitter for track use, but I'll probably never actually get around to that, so I might as well pass it on to someone else.

As I said, it doesn't fit on the 2.5GT bumper. I don't have ready access to any other bumpers, so I can't say for certain, but I think it might fit this style:
http://www.mercadolibre.cl/jm/img?s=...8_2392.jpg&v=O . Notice in that picture that the big opening in the lower bumper extends beyond the outside edges of the grille, whereas (in the pictures below) you can see the lower opening in the 2.5GT bumper is basically the same width as the grille.

I used a box to prop up the middle just so you can see the center portion is too wide to match up to my style of bumper:

The lip is, in fact, a direct fit on the bumper type that I thought it would fit on, the old base model style. The bumper cover even has all the mounting holes there to attach it, so Jonathan just needs to pick up some fasteners and he'll be good to go.
